ATLANTA (AP) — A federal judge on Thursday rejected a lawsuit by a former Democratic congressman running for Georgia state Supreme Court who claimed a state agency was unconstitutionally trying to block him from talking about abortion.

U.S. District Judge Michael Brown ruled John Barrow didn't have standing to sue because Barrow himself a confidential letter from the Georgia Judicial Qualifications Commission and because his continued public statements show his speech isn't being restricted.
